Your sector must respond to the paradox of reconciling descending prices with regulatory requirements and customer demands

  • Knowledge of the customers is the constant prerequisite at all stages of the relationship between your sales forces and the buyers of the customer purchase organization (clientele segmentation, customer hierarchy with application dates, cascading sales terms, rebate contracts, etc.)
  • ADAX takes charge of the management of your production, transformation and conditioning of agro-food products according to the standards in force
  • Backward and forward traceability is ensured throughout the process thanks to batch numbers and automatic data capture on the materials, packaging and finished products
  • The transport of fresh products is optimized thanks to  functions that help in the choice of carriers and improve your delivery circuits (consolidation/de-consolidation)

Needs

    Monitor customer relations to guarantee their satisfaction
  • Management of transactions is increasingly complex. Track the sales terms applied to each transaction, explain the detail of the calculations and terms applied and not applied (e.g. why has this discount not been applied?). Block quotes/orders that do not correspond to your best practices (e.g. credit limit exceeded, insufficient margin, overly high discount, unusual order, etc.) and automatically alert the corresponding person in charge.
  • Define replenishment rules adapted to each item to avoid shortage of items in the supply chain.
  • Rely on a CRM (Customer Relationship Management) system with numerous functions specific to your sector: customer hierarchy (with date of validity), advanced pricing and discounts, promotions management, rebates, referenced items, customer claims, history of actions, targeted marketing campaigns, etc.
